Channel Superhero: What’s the biggest influence on the characters of Hope and Faith?
Pat Bishow: I sort of based them on El Frenetico and Go-Girl (a film I made in the 90s) and Oscar and Felix from the odd couple. Go-Girl was both smart and could kick ass. So I split her up. We wanted them to be very different so you can’t imagine they could ever live together.
Alex Covington: I think in the creation of Faith, from my perspective, I draw from other nerdy, yet super-cool girls, like Nancy Drew. But honestly, there is a lot of Faith within me. LOL I’m a pretty hopeful person, I look on the bright side of things, and I believe in people. But I’m not ditzy about it!
Rica de Ocampo: It depends on what’s going on in the moment. When I’m playing Riley, I tend to think of my brother. (His name is Migo) He’s an amateur MAMA fighter who plays a ton of video games, teaches tennis to children, and once had an obsession with competitive eating. My brother tends to be blunt and straightforward like Riley. Often when I’m eating my 4th cookie and spouting out a harsh yet hilarious comment, I think about how my brother would do it.
When I’m in the superhero get up and beating people up as Hope I’m influenced by a number of things. A lot of the time I think about my friends and family that I grew up with. We all took Tae Kwon Do and used to do karate demos around the Northern Virginia and DC. Most of the time it was a 10 year old me fighting my 24 year old, 6’2″ brother, Kofi. He and I would choreograph fun fight sequences where I would kick him in the face and throw him around a bunch.
The other main influence has got to be Buffy. I’m a Buffy fanatic! And if I’m being super specific, I often think of Faith (Eliza Dusku) when I’m playing Hope. Faith was such a badass chick with a heart of gold who at one point strayed from the hero path but returned and found redemption. I think Hope is so similar!
